Job description

Senior Research Associate As a hands-on molecular biology expert, you will play a key role in advancing Dyno’s animal studies to identify and develop cutting-edge muscle AAV-based capsids. You will process and analyze tissues from in vivo studies, support histology workflows, and conduct in vitro experiments to characterize leading capsids and capsid libraries. Working closely with Research Associates, Scientists, and Computational Biologists, you will help the Muscle team generate high-quality data that shapes the future of gene therapy.

How You Will Contribute

As a Senior Research Associate, you will provide hands-on experimental support across tissue processing, molecular measurements, histology, and in vitro characterization. You will work alongside a team of talented scientists and contribute to a diverse range of projects. Your role will require you to optimize workflows, troubleshoot problems, and ensure successful project outcomes by aligning with team goals.

Responsibilities:

  • Sample inventory and dissection of tissues (mammalian cells, non-human primate and mouse tissues).
  • Extract, purify, and enrich nucleic acids from mammalian cells and tissues.
  • Run quantification assays on purified nucleic acids (e.g., qPCR, RT-qPCR).
  • Prepare next-generation sequencing libraries (amplicon sequencing) and perform associated QC steps.
  • Support histology workflows, including tissue preparation, sectioning, staining, imaging, and analysis.
  • Maintain mammalian cell cultures and execute cell-based experiments to characterize leading muscle capsids and capsid libraries.
  • Analyze experimental data, identify technical issues, and recommend appropriate next steps in collaboration with project leads.
  • Maintain detailed and accurate records of samples, experimental procedures, and results using Dyno’s electronic laboratory notebook and LIMS systems.
  • Communicate findings clearly and collaborate across experimental and computational teams to achieve project goals.
  • Adhere to lab protocols and safety regulations to ensure a safe working environment.

Preferred qualifications

  • Experience with AAV biology, gene therapy, viral vectors, or drug-delivery technologies.
  • Experience with next-generation sequencing library preparation.
  • Experience processing animal tissues for molecular measurements, including vector genome, mRNA, or protein analysis.
  • Experience with histology workflows, including tissue preparation, sectioning, staining, imaging, or quantitative analysis.
  • Familiarity with ELN-LIMS data management software (e.g. Benchling).
